如何确定哪些专用PPA减慢了更新速度?


9

我的系统上安装了几个PPA。每次执行一次操作apt-get update时,更新过程都会停留在该位置(持续近一分钟):

Ign https://private-ppa.launchpad.net precise/main TranslationIndex
Ign https://private-ppa.launchpad.net precise/main Translation-it
Ign https://private-ppa.launchpad.net precise/main Translation-en
100% [In lavorazione]

(我不知道英语的最后一行是怎么回事,例如“ 100%[工作中]”)

我认为发生这种情况是因为PPA的下载速度很慢。(您认为这可能是原因吗?)

如果是这样,我想从系统中删除该PPA。问题在于,在此阶段中,我无法区分PPA,因为所有PPA都显示以下URL :https://private-ppa.launchpad.net precise/main。有没有办法确定在特定时刻正在更新的PPA?


您真的需要apt-get update在一分钟内完成吗?在我的系统上,这大约需要3-4分钟,因为我的互联网连接速度很慢,而且我看不到它可能会造成干扰。
拉斐尔·西埃拉克(RafałCieślak)2012年

我想知道是否有一种方法可以加快这一过程。如果您说那是生理时间,对我来说没关系,这并不打扰。
米歇尔2012年

Answers:


6

使用sudo apt-get -o Debug::Acquire::http=true -o Acquire::Queue-Mode=access update。这将启用调试选项,以使所有HTTP请求顺序执行,并向您显示每个HTTP请求发出的响应和返回的响应。


0

您可能会在/etc/apt/sources.list上注释所引用的PPA条目,然后再次进行更新,看看它是否一直卡住。


1
谢谢你,问题是,我不能确定,因为PPA所有这些节目的同时更新同一行:https://private-ppa.launchpad.net precise/main
米雪(Michele)
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.